The Interaction Sequence in Counseling: A Systems Perspective.
Ridley, Charles R.
Counseling Psychologist, v17 n3 p463-65 Jul 1989
Claims Claiborn and Lichtenberg in "Interactional Counseling" (1989) have achieved their goal of providing integration and coherence to the theory, practice, and research of the previously nonintegrated counseling domain with distinction. Recommends a new training paradigm is needed to achieve the goal of self-modification of counselors' response style. (ABL)
